Frequently asked questions about Northwest Integrated Health - Lakewood Clinic

Does Northwest Integrated Health - Lakewood Clinic accept insurance?+

Northwest Integrated Health - Lakewood Clinic reports accepting Medicare, Medicaid, Private insurance, TRICARE, State-financed insurance, and Self-pay, though this has not been independently verified — contact the facility directly to confirm your specific plan is covered.

What levels of care does Northwest Integrated Health - Lakewood Clinic offer?+

Northwest Integrated Health - Lakewood Clinic offers Outpatient, Regular outpatient, Intensive outpatient (IOP), Outpatient MAT, telehealth, IOP, outpatient, opioid treatment program (OTP), buprenorphine maintenance, methadone maintenance, and psychiatry / medication management.

Does Northwest Integrated Health - Lakewood Clinic offer telehealth or virtual appointments?+

Yes, Northwest Integrated Health - Lakewood Clinic offers telehealth appointments in addition to any in-person services listed on this page.

What age groups does Northwest Integrated Health - Lakewood Clinic serve?+

Northwest Integrated Health - Lakewood Clinic serves adults.

What conditions or specialties does Northwest Integrated Health - Lakewood Clinic treat?+

Northwest Integrated Health - Lakewood Clinic lists the following areas of focus: trauma, dual diagnosis, domestic violence, sexual abuse survivors, and pregnant/postpartum.

Is Northwest Integrated Health - Lakewood Clinic accredited or licensed?+

Northwest Integrated Health - Lakewood Clinic is licensed as State substance use agency, State mental health department, and State department of health and is certified for SAMHSA-certified Opioid Treatment Program and DEA registered, as reported to SAMHSA. Confirm current standing with the accrediting body before making a decision.

What languages does Northwest Integrated Health - Lakewood Clinic support?+

Northwest Integrated Health - Lakewood Clinic reports support for Spanish, American Sign Language, Hindi, and Vietnamese.
